I ordered from several. Ribbles.co.uk is the site where I bought the cassette. I also bought the groupset and brakes from them that have been delivered. The groupset was the most expensive item. It's not Ribble's fault.
I suspect it's our lovely customs that lost it. Any time the government touches something, it has a good chance of going bad. |